I too am a Clapp descended from Roger Clap, through Northampton Clapp's, Preserved and Lt.Asahel Clapp, son Chester Clapp.(And Boston Clapp's)
My family lines are Wallace/Wallis,(who settled in Colrain, Ma,) Hunt,(who settled Bath, Maine), and Bruce (who settled in Sudbury, MA, VT and Maine.
Currently, and for the past 15yrs., searching for John Gorham Clapp's death in Boston, Ma area about 1861-62. He was born in Northampton, MA, 1832, son of Chester Clapp of NOrthampton and Boston, MA. He married Mary Hanna Mallett in Boston, 1856. Their son, Frederick Irving Clapp was my ggrandfather.

Elisha Clapp Sr 1803 TN - 1851 TX. There is no Tom Clapp in this family.
Elisha Sr's linage includes Elisha Clapp Jr who lived in Madison Co TX.
He had a son Elisha Clapp III born
He had a son Thomas Holland Clapp born 1890 in Madison Co TX and died ca 1967; I have no other details. He was on the census from 1900-1930.
Siblings were:
James Allen Clapp 1883 -
Elisha Clapp 1886 -
William "Billie" Clapp 1888 -
WWI Draft Registration
Name: Thomas Holland Clapp
Birth: 14 Nov 1890
Birth: Texas;United States of America
Residence: Not Stated, Madison, Texas
Other: Madison County
1920 census - wife Arrie, born ca 1897
Madison County marriage records: CLAPP, Thomas H. BOZEMAN, Arrie 12 Sep 1916

I am Descended from Roger Clapp (1630).
I resided in Madison County, TX for 7 years during the 1990s.
The Clapp's that were there were decendants of Jacob Clapp who settled in NC.Jacob was a German. There are many Clapp's buried in Madison County and Houston County. At one time there were several family members in Midway but to the best of my knowledge There are no Clapp's left in the county.
